
HardyDisk Cefiderocol 30µg Susceptibility Disks
Hardy Diagnostics recalls HardyDisk Cefiderocol 30µg disks due to incorrect cartridges that may cause false susceptibility results.
Do not use the affected HardyDisk AST Cefiderocol 30µg (FDC30) REF Z9435 disks. Contact Hardy Diagnostics for instructions on returning the affected product and obtaining a replacement.

Why it was recalled
Hardy Diagnostics is recalling HardyDisk AST Cefiderocol 30µg (FDC30) REF Z9435 disks used for in vitro susceptibility testing. Incorrect cartridges included in affected products may cause false-susceptible or false-resistant results, potentially leading to ineffective antimicrobial therapy and worsening clinical outcomes.
